TOP 8 Tips to Make Homework Easier

Homework must be a time when students find the subject visible in class and can think of it from a new perspective. In this way, understanding and assimilating content takes on new meaning.

Homework must be a time when the child finds the subject visible in class and can think of it from a new perspective. In this way, understanding and assimilating content takes on new meaning. When well designed, homework can greatly help students understand and internalize what they have seen in class. The knowledge around him, nearby, leaps into him. To be his.

To do this, teachers need – and hope they can count on – a little support from their parents, their families. Then some stumbling blocks can start happening and what should help be a source of regret and scolding. I will try to give some tips here to make homework time more profitable for parents and children. There he is!

1) Father, mother, although many are aware of this, the first tip is: You have left school. So the task is up to your child. Who should do it is him and not you. This may seem obvious, but for many parents, in the daily grind, doing it for their child has become a way to rest early and hear less regret. But the results will come and may come in the form of disapproval, from future adults with the wrong character being interpreted that everyone must serve him. I’m sure you don’t want this for your puppy, do you?

2) Make sure that homework is part of the routine. Performing tasks must be normal in the child’s daily life. Depending on your child’s age, agree with him what time is best according to family reality. After approval, the time must be fulfilled, and you, the parent, have the role to make it happen. Running that time, this commitment, will help them consolidate their parenting authority.

3) Try to provide a peaceful learning environment. Favorite places in front of the television may be quiet, but not for homework.

4) Enjoy the moment of assignment as quality time between you and your children. Consider whether it is interesting to be present 100% of the time or whether a constant and encouraging past is enough. What is important for the child to realize that you are there for him, support him.

5) When the task allows reflection, ask questions that lead your child to find answers that will help him practice his reasons. Don’t make the answer too clear.

6) The tips above also apply in some ways when your child asks questions. Be careful because the answer is not so straightforward to take your chance to think for yourself about this problem.

7) After the assignment is complete, review with your child. This will give them one more chance to embed content, you get the chance to find out their answers and gradually it will become a good habit for them.

How to Write an Essay

Do you need to write an essay? Then it is very good to know how to approach the task. It seems difficult to write an essay, but once you master the principles, it’s not bad at all. Actually, writing an essay can be very fun and exciting because you are allowed to be very personal and learn topics that you find interesting.

What is an essay?

The word ‘essay’ comes from the Latin ‘exagium’ which means ‘learning’. And that’s actually the essay. In an essay, you need to research, evaluate, and reflect on a topic so that your teacher can understand your thoughts. In an essay you may want to discuss various points of view, but it is important that your essay will not be a long discussion. It’s more about the problem itself than about the different points of view, so it’s about making the problem focused by explaining it in a different way.

Here are some tips for writing your essay:

1. Choose the topic for your essay

In an essay, your job often is that you have to write about the text that you have given or about a topic that you care about. In addition to describing the text or topic of the essay, you must also write about your own attitude to the essay – therefore it is important that you choose something that you have (or may have) a clear opinion about and that can be seen from several pages. . And fortunately, an essay shows that you can be creative and write a little more interesting than you normally do.

2. Build your essay

Start your essay with concrete experience – maybe an article you’ve read that addresses a community problem, or maybe an everyday situation that you normally encounter.
After you describe it in your essay, you can slowly start moving out where you put the situation into perspective, explaining the topic to a greater extent. That is, you are comparing a specific situation with some larger context, where it becomes a little more abstract in your essay.

Tip! For example, you might start by writing about the fact that you have to submit your essay because your printer isn’t working (a special situation) and you end up discussing technological advances in society – from quill pens to keyboards. To make your essay more comprehensive, it is a good idea to divide it into paragraphs that you provide subheadings. It also helps you keep track of where you are in your essay.

3. Discuss in your essay

Tell about your own attitude towards the problem you encountered in your essay. Please provide one or more examples that explain what you mean so that it becomes clear to the reader what you think. But don’t forget that you also have to look at the case from the other side. So even if you have written your clear stance, you also need to understand what others think that disagrees with you. Hold the two views of each other and discuss a little with yourself. “On the one hand … On the other …” Always remember that this is about explaining the topic from a different perspective – this is not about the discussion itself.

Tip! Remember to emphasize your personal attitude in the essay. You need to show that you are interested in the subject and it is important for you to convey your intentions. If not, it may be difficult for readers to believe what you write in your essay.
